Tropika Island of Treasure makes its triumphant return for an eleventh season, this time against the stunning backdrop of Zanzibar. The beloved reality competition show is back on your screens, and the first 5 episodes have been nothing short of riveting. The show delivers star-studded entertainment, thrilling challenges, and the biggest prize in TIOT history: a shared R1 million and a brand new Suzuki Jimny for the two members of the winning team.



Seven ordinary South Africans embark on the journey of a lifetime, trading their daily routines for the exotic island paradise. They are paired with and compete alongside an exciting lineup of celebrity contestants, Tiktoker extraordinaire Chad Jones, sports presenter  Nqobile Khwezi, former Miss SA Ndavi Nokeri, heartthrob model Karl Kugelmann, actor Hungani Ndlovu, and TV sweetheart Roxy Burger as well as smooth serenader Bobby van Jaarsveld as they battle it out in a series of exhilarating physical and mental challenges.

Hosted by South Africa’s media darling, Zanele Potelwa, the new season of Tropika Island of Treasure is bigger and better than ever, with jaw-dropping challenges, unexpected twists and heartwarming moments.



The action has been intense on the show and some teams found their heads on the chopping block as they were eliminated from the competition. Team Pineapple (Chad Jones and Ryan Cummings) saw their demise in episode 3 after losing in the bow and arrow challenge, the journey came to an end for team Tropical (Nqobile Khwezi and Gloria Ngcobo) in episode 5 after coming last in the “Pole Pole” game. Team Mixed Berries are at the head of the leaderboard Karl and Stacy and are proving formidable.
